Can dealerships remain open on Saturday and Sunday in TEXAS?

Dealerships in Texas are allowed to commence their business operations on Sunday as they are not prohibited by any law. Certainly, they have a law that states dealership cannot operate on both Saturday and Sunday which means they have to close at least one day. At the time of holidays, it’s illegal to operate the car dealership for a whole day.
